el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Guía actualizada para evitar que un ransomware ataque tu empresa


+  Foro de elhacker.net
|-+  Programación
| |-+  Programación General
| | |-+  ASM (Moderador: Eternal Idol)
| | | |-+  ayuda con codigo para entender ASM (DIsculpa por el doble espot )
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: ayuda con codigo para entender ASM (DIsculpa por el doble espot )  (Leído 4,423 veces)
DragonsWP

Desconectado Desconectado

Mensajes: 23


Ver Perfil
ayuda con codigo para entender ASM (DIsculpa por el doble espot )
« en: 31 Diciembre 2009, 12:45 pm »

 ayuda con codigo para entender
« en: Ayer a las 22:28 » 

--------------------------------------------------------------------------------
hola me gustaria que me ayudaran porfavor empese con esamblador pero poco se, la necesidad llamo mas rapido
Código:
MyThread19 proc
    tecla:
    invoke Sleep, 10

    invoke GetAsyncKeyState, VK_NUMPAD0
    test eax, eax
    jz tecla

push eax
mov eax,35490F14h
mov eax,[eax]
mov byte ptr[eax+0E1ACh],045h
mov byte ptr[eax+0E1C0h],045h
mov byte ptr[eax+0E1D4h],045h
    jmp tecla

ret

MyThread19 endp


MyThread20 proc
    tecla1:
    invoke Sleep, 10

    invoke GetAsyncKeyState,VK_NUMPAD1
    test eax, eax
    jz tecla1

push eax
mov eax,35490F14h
mov eax,[eax]
mov byte ptr[eax+0E1ACh],059h //esta parte es la diferencia entre el 0 y el 1
mov byte ptr[eax+0E1C0h],059h
mov byte ptr[eax+0E1D4h],059h
    jmp tecla1

ret

MyThread20 endp
este code es parte de una dll echa en asm para un juego lo que hace es editar valores pero ya que el juego actualizo no se como actulizar el code, eh buscado con el enginer y no encuentro la parte que vario
el dll tiene la funciona que cuando apreto el numero 0 pad hace que mi criatura cambie, y el numero 1 que cambie a otra, porfavor me podriam explicar mejor


En línea

B14573R

Desconectado Desconectado

Mensajes: 30


Aprende a defenderte para luego saver como atacar


Ver Perfil
Re: ayuda con codigo para entender ASM (DIsculpa por el doble espot )
« Respuesta #1 en: 26 Enero 2010, 02:44 am »

viejo si recien estas entrando a ASm empiesa con 16bits  y con tasm  espero averte alludado


En línea

SI SAVES DEFENDERTE SABRAS COMO ATACAR
SI SAVES COMO ATACAR SABRAS DEFENDERTE
.......................
YST


Desconectado Desconectado

Mensajes: 965


I'm you


Ver Perfil WWW
Re: ayuda con codigo para entender ASM (DIsculpa por el doble espot )
« Respuesta #2 en: 26 Enero 2010, 03:31 am »

No se puede hacer nada sin saber que juego es ni nada :P

Por cierto no quiero empezar como siempre la discucion pero 16 bits no es lo mejor para aprender :P
En línea



Yo le enseñe a Kayser a usar objetos en ASM
Amerikano|Cls


Desconectado Desconectado

Mensajes: 789


[Beyond This Life]


Ver Perfil WWW
Re: ayuda con codigo para entender ASM (DIsculpa por el doble espot )
« Respuesta #3 en: 26 Enero 2010, 04:32 am »

viejo si recien estas entrando a ASm empiesa con 16bits  y con tasm  espero averte alludado

Porque tiene que ser precisamente 16 bits?, perfectamente puede leerse algun texto de 32bits por lo menos es mi parecer, ademas yo hice asi  ;)
En línea





Mi blog:
http://amerikanocls.blogspot.com
Eternal Idol
Kernel coder
Moderador
***
Desconectado Desconectado

Mensajes: 5.958


Israel nunca torturó niños, ni lo volverá a hacer.


Ver Perfil WWW
Re: ayuda con codigo para entender ASM (DIsculpa por el doble espot )
« Respuesta #4 en: 26 Enero 2010, 08:32 am »

Eso parece ser un cheat, lo unico que hace finalmente es escribir un valor en una direccion hardcodeada ... busca la nueva direccion.
En línea

La economía nunca ha sido libre: o la controla el Estado en beneficio del Pueblo o lo hacen los grandes consorcios en perjuicio de éste.
Juan Domingo Perón
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  

Mensajes similares
Asunto Iniciado por Respuestas Vistas Último mensaje
Ayuda con GetPixel (Ingresa para entender)
.NET (C#, VB.NET, ASP)
GonzaFz 1 2,474 Último mensaje 25 Mayo 2012, 17:13 pm
por Maurice_Lupin
ayuda para entender código en c++
Programación C/C++
migcv 5 4,143 Último mensaje 8 Noviembre 2012, 15:38 pm
por rir3760
(Ayuda) Entender un código
Programación C/C++
Seyro97 2 2,208 Último mensaje 6 Diciembre 2014, 17:05 pm
por Seyro97
[AYUDA] Necesito entender el código - C++
Programación C/C++
Alape04 1 1,658 Último mensaje 21 Octubre 2016, 05:27 am
por palacio29
Problemas para entender un codigo
Programación C/C++
DanteS00 0 1,444 Último mensaje 9 Julio 2018, 22:41 pm
por DanteS00
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ines